OVERVIEW: I came here with a dinner-time pizza craving after an evening of ice skating in the adjacent and connecting building. Ample parking, and even designated Brooksy's parking spots to ensure patrons don't end up parking super far away due to saturated Ice Center guests.AMBIANCE: Very chill area. Walked up the steps through heavy wooden doors to the bar area and people playing table shuffleboard. I walked over to the main dining area, which was plentiful, and there were families and groups dining, watching one of the many TVs, or watching the hockey practice going on across the glass. SERVICE: I placed my takeout order with Jennifer, who helped me make some executive decisions for what my 10 year-old might like. I waited about 25 minutes for my food (no problem, she let me sit in a booth to wait and I browsed the internet, watched TV, and watched bits of hockey). To be fair she told me the wait would be about that time, so she did a great job setting the expectations. When our to-go order came out, The owner, John (?) came out, apologized for the delay, and made me aware that the pizza cooked and had a hole in it. I was perplexed at the disclosure, but when he opened the pizza I chuckled because there truly was no problem. Perhaps a thin spot in the dough when thinning it out, but I had zero issue with it. I tried to negate his need to apologize for anything but he insisted on making it right and gave us a far too generous gift certificate for a future visit. I told him it was unnecessary, but he insisted. I CANNOT speak highly enough of the attention to detail and customer service this place has!FOOD: Absolutely amazing! We got a Buffalo Chicken Pizza and it was a perfect flavor meld of buffalo wings and pizza. The cheese was perfectly gooey, the chicken was delicious, the crust had a great light char on the undercarriage, and man, I am not one to eat a lot of pizza crusts (usually they end up with the texture of cardboard) but holy moly this crust was good! Crispy on the outside, firm enough under the bulk of the pizza, but soft and tender on the inside! Best crust I've had, ever. We also got medium wings, perfectly cooked, tender insides, crispy outsides, and flavored well. They also hooked it up with plenty of blue cheese, carrots, and celery. My daughter got chicken tenders, and she demolished them, lol.OVERALL: Absolutely recommend. This has the vibes of a laidback bar and grill where everyone knows everyone else, and the fact that it's attached to my home ice rink is such a great plus! The food was amazing, but the service and the care they provide really puts this place over the top. Will definitely be back!

Was in Vegas for a soccer tournament and was looking for somewhere to grab dinner and watch some sports on the TV and came across Brooksy's (on Yelp of course)!OMG. Everything is worth ordering. I wish I had a month here to keep coming back for more. The ambience is really cool. This is the first time I have ever been to a sports themed restaurant with a direct view into a live working hockey rink! We got to watch two team practicing while we also watched ncaa basketball on the TV's (6 of them!). They are open 24 hours and still manage to keep the quality high. They have a breakfast menu with omelets, eggs anyway you want them, pancakes, and even a Nutella stuffed waffle. They also have great sandwich dishes like Philly Cheesesteaks, and French Dip, meatball or Italian sausage. They even have soups in the menu to warm you up. We started off with buffalo wings and they were really delicious. The sauce actually tasted house made and had a really nice balance of sweet and heat. All that said, the star of the show was the pizza. We ordered a large Butcher Block and could only eat half! It was phenomenal. They have a full bar, and a couple of good beer options as well. The restaurant side was definitely family friendly and our waitress Jennifer was amazing and kept bringing us refills of the Mug root beer. Give them a chance!
